Em Tue, Dec 30, 2003 at 05:32:30PM +0100, Ingo Molnar escreveu:
> 
> i recently wasted a few hours on a bug where i used "tcp_sk(sock)"
> instead of "tcp_sk(sock->sk)" - the former, while being blatantly
> incorrect, compiles just fine on 2.6.0. The patch below is equivalent to
> the define but is also type-safe. Compiles cleanly & boots fine on
> 2.6.0.

Don't have a problem, but then it'd be nice to do this for udp_sk, raw_sk,
etc, etc :)
